Unit test for fdo#79941 (handle short reads)
...done as a subsequentcheck as doing it as a BootstrapFixtureBase (which is the easiest way) makes it depend on later modules in the dependency chain. Change-Id: I9588bae409b38aa373ccfa855042f598b6e2bb2b

+namespace {
+
+class Input: public cppu::WeakImplHelper1<css::io::XInputStream> {
+public:
+ Input(): open_(true), index_(0) {}
+
+private:
+ virtual ~Input() {}
+
+ sal_Int32 SAL_CALL readBytes(css::uno::Sequence<sal_Int8> &, sal_Int32)
+ throw (
+ css::io::NotConnectedException,
+ css::io::BufferSizeExceededException, css::io::IOException,
+ css::uno::RuntimeException, std::exception)
+ SAL_OVERRIDE
+ { CPPUNIT_FAIL("readLine is supposed to call readSomeBytes instead"); }
+
+ sal_Int32 SAL_CALL readSomeBytes(
+ css::uno::Sequence<sal_Int8 > & aData, sal_Int32 nMaxBytesToRead)
+ throw (
+ css::io::NotConnectedException,
+ css::io::BufferSizeExceededException, css::io::IOException,
+ css::uno::RuntimeException, ::std::exception) SAL_OVERRIDE
+ {
+ assert(nMaxBytesToRead >= 0);
+ osl::MutexGuard g(mutex_);
+ checkClosed();
+ assert(index_ >= 0 && index_ <= SIZE);
+ sal_Int32 n = std::min<sal_Int32>(
+ std::min<sal_Int32>(nMaxBytesToRead, 2), SIZE - index_);
+ assert(n >= 0 && n <= SIZE - index_);
+ aData.realloc(n);
+ std::memcpy(aData.getArray(), data + index_, n);
+ index_ += n;
+ assert(index_ >= 0 && index_ <= SIZE);
+ return n;
+ }
+
+ void SAL_CALL skipBytes(sal_Int32 nBytesToSkip)
+ throw (
+ css::io::NotConnectedException,
+ css::io::BufferSizeExceededException, css::io::IOException,
+ css::uno::RuntimeException, std::exception) SAL_OVERRIDE
+ {
+ assert(nBytesToSkip >= 0);
+ osl::MutexGuard g(mutex_);
+ checkClosed();
+ assert(index_ >= 0 && index_ <= SIZE);
+ index_ += std::min<sal_Int32>(nBytesToSkip, SIZE - index_);
+ assert(index_ >= 0 && index_ <= SIZE);
+ }
+
+ sal_Int32 SAL_CALL available()
+ throw (
+ css::io::NotConnectedException, css::io::IOException,
+ css::uno::RuntimeException, std::exception) SAL_OVERRIDE
+ {
+ osl::MutexGuard g(mutex_);
+ checkClosed();
+ assert(index_ >= 0 && index_ <= SIZE);
+ return SIZE - index_;
+ }
+
+ void SAL_CALL closeInput()
+ throw (
+ css::io::NotConnectedException, css::io::IOException,
+ css::uno::RuntimeException, std::exception) SAL_OVERRIDE
+ {
+ osl::MutexGuard g(mutex_);
+ checkClosed();
+ open_ = true;
+ }
+
+ void checkClosed() {
+ if (!open_) {
+ throw css::io::NotConnectedException(
+ "test input stream already closed");
+ }
+ }
+
+ static sal_Int32 const SIZE = 9;
+ static char const data[SIZE];
+
+ osl::Mutex mutex_;
+ bool open_;
+ sal_Int32 index_;
+};
+
+char const Input::data[] = { '1', '2', '3', '4', '5', '6', '7', '8', '9' };
+
+class Test: public test::BootstrapFixtureBase {
+private:
+ CPPUNIT_TEST_SUITE(Test);
+ CPPUNIT_TEST(testReadLine);
+ CPPUNIT_TEST_SUITE_END();
+
+ void testReadLine();
+};
+
+void Test::testReadLine() {
+ css::uno::Reference<css::io::XTextInputStream2> s(
+ css::io::TextInputStream::create(getComponentContext()));
+ s->setInputStream(new Input);
+ rtl::OUString l(s->readLine());
+ CPPUNIT_ASSERT_EQUAL(rtl::OUString("123456789"), l);
+}
+
+CPPUNIT_TEST_SUITE_REGISTRATION(Test);
+
+}
